Default just a note when comparing data logs from K04 car with K03 software that ran 13.66 and,,

the K04 car with detuned K04 software to the K04 car with new software.
The new software in 2nd gear alone was .48 seconds faster between 3300 and 6400rpms than the car with the K03 software that ran 13.66. It was also faster than the detuned software.
Need to get some more data logs and then head to Carlsbad for some slips to compare.
I was Vag tool to do the timing with blocks 003 and 115. Compared them to the same blocks taken for each software change.
Wonder what this all equates to at the drags?? Could it mean the car has the potential to turn 13 flats or better? DOnt know.
